The Kendall Group in Lansing, MI is seeking a Location Support Representative to direct calls, greet customers, and provide general office support within a fast-paced, employee-owned environment.
You will use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, Teams) and a multi-line switchboard, maintain business processes, and assist with payments and reporting while building strong relationships with customers and teammates.
About The Kendall Group The Kendall Group is comprised of eight divisions with 75+ locations in ten states. Combined, we serve the Electrical, Automation, Pipe, Valve, and Fitting products, Steam, Lighting, Industrial Controls, and Instrumentation Industries. Reporting to the Territory/Location Manager, the Location Support Representative role will be primarily responsible for directing incoming calls, greeting customers, and general office support.
2 Years of Receptionist/Office Assistant Experience
High School Diploma or GED equivalent
Prior experience and familiarity of multi-line switchboard and Microsoft Office Systems: Excel, Word, Teams, and Office
Excellent work ethic, good verbal, time management and communication skills; ability to work independently and as a part of a team; ability to multi-task
Ability to work effectively in a team environment and through the direction of a Territory Manager; work well with others, and ability to explain your work and/or train them on your efforts
Strong interpersonal communications, analytical and problem solving, organizational and written/verbal communication skills
